L.A.'s high-end real estate market is experiencing a slowdown, with fewer megadeals and price reductions. Brokerages report increased smaller transactions compensating for this trend. Despite macroeconomic challenges, Beverly Hills Estates reported a strong first quarter. Newport Coast has seen significant price drops, with a median home price down nearly 21% year-over-year. However, it remains a leading market for high-value deals, exemplified by a recent $30 million sale. The brokerage aims to expand its growth both locally and internationally.
